    Quote Originally Posted by Lois_Lane View Post
    I just contacted Kalayaan and they told me that I basically just need to submit an application form for the extension of her domestic worker visa with her payslips, employment contract, a letter stating we want to continue employing her, our bank statements, her passport and copies of me and my husband's passports. :-)

    With effect from October 1st 2012 the current National Minimum wage is £6.19 per hour

    There are regulations concerning whether or not the NMW applies to certain domestic workers or not.
    It's not so straightforward.

    Hello Vilma,

    Under the UK law, the private household worker as far as I know does not have to be paid the lowest minimum wage if he/she is living with you in your own house and not paying any bills or food or anything. If she is full time working for you. If she lives somewhere else than your home, i believe you need to pay her at least the minimum wage. Our country also has a rule right now that domestic workers abroad should be paid more than $400 a month but those in POEA who signs the exit clearance as well as the Philippine Embassy London advised us to pay at least £500 pounds a month and not lower so that we get approved by POEA in our country and so on... This is what i know and what i experienced.

    As far as i know now, if you employ a domestic worker after April 2012, they are only allowed here if approved, a maximum of 6 months stay. It has changed this year.

    Fortunately for us. We got our nanny's visa and she arrived here before April 2012. She arrived here on 27th March 2012. So, our nanny can renew her visa every year.
